I got some of those cute Lime Green Mickey's at Home Depot too.
If you soak the card in hot water for a few seconds the paint chip comes right off. Then you have a nice Mickey head that is much thinner than when it is glued to the cardboard. Peggie

My son's room is painted Galatic (sp) blue and there are several "hidden mickey's" in his room.

I took the sample paint chips, cut them out and glued a few of them (in the same color) on the walls.
 
I took my pin trading logo and printed off a copy to place in the middle of the Mickey head on the card. I then took Disney stickers from my scrapbooking stuff and covered all the writing on the cards. I made them 2 sided and laminated them today at Kinkos. I have punched holes in them and plan on using key rings to attach them to zippers on our backpack and camera bags. I think they will also attach to our pin lanyards.
